We are seeking a detail-oriented and organized Accounting Analyst to join our GL Accounting team in the Manila office.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ing daily cash activities, assisting with manual journal entries, and playing a key role in the month-end close cycle. To facilitate seamless collaboration with our core General Ledger team based in California, USA, this role operates on a fixed schedule of 6:00 AM to 3:00 PM Philippine Time (PHT).
Key Responsibilities:
Daily & Weekly Tasks:
- Perform daily bank reconciliations for global bank accounts across AMER, APAC, and EMEA regions, ensuring all transactions are accurately recorded in Workday (our ERP system).
- Prepare and post ad-hoc journal entries for bank fees, intercompany transfers, and other miscellaneous transactions.
- Prepare and record month-end and quarter-end journal entries, such as intercompany loan interest
- Prepare analysis that supports the month-end financial results, such as contractor cost review
- Assist in administrative tasks of the GL accounting team, such as maintaining close calendars and checklists
- Prepare and upload reconciliation schedules for cash and other accounts into our financial close software (FloQast).
- Assist in identifying and resolving month-end accounting errors in collaboration with the wider accounting team.
- Prepare and provide necessary materials to support the financial reporting team, including monthly schedules, statements, and PBC requests.
Qualifications & Skills:
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, CPA is a plus
- 4+ years of Public Accounting or Industry experience, Big 4 experience is a plus, global company/shared service company experience is a plus
- Ability to maintain a working schedule of 6:00 AM to 3:00 PM (PHT) to ensure adequate overlap and real-time support with the US Pacific Time Zone team.
- Experience with enterprise-level ERP systems is required; specific experience with Workday is highly preferred.
- Strong written and verbal English skills. No communication challenges when working with the US onshore teams.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el (VLOOKUP, pivot tables) is required.
- Experience working with multiple legal entities and currencies in a global business environment.
- Strong understanding of US GAAP/IFRS and the month-end close process.
- Excellent organ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ines.
